Карта сайта Kansoftware
НОВОСТИУСЛУГИРЕШЕНИЯКОНТАКТЫ
KANSoftWare

Записи :: Базы данных :: База знаний Delphi

:: Вставка новой записи через буфер
В статье описывается способ вставки новой записи в таблицу Delphi через буфер активной записи таблицы Table1.

:: Дубликат Paradox или dBase записи
Статья рассматривает проблема дублирования записи из таблицы Paradox в Delphi-приложении, предлагая необычное решение с помощью процедуры Insert и Move для переноса данных между двумя таблицами.

:: Запись nnn из nnn
В статье описан способ получения номера текущей записи в таблице dBASE из Delphi, который заключается в использовании компонента DBNavigator и BDE.

:: Запись RecNo из RecordCount
В статье описывается функция RecordNumber, которая возвращает номер текущей записи в наборе данных DataSet, а также пример ее использования в обработчике события OnDataChange для вывода информации о текущей записи и общем количестве записей.

:: Как выбрать случайную запись
В статье описывается способ выбора случайной записи в базе данных с помощью процедуры на языке Delphi.

:: Как добавить копию текущей записи
Программный код на языке Delphi, позволяющий добавить копию текущей записи в dataset.

:: Как перейти к указанной записи в БД
В статье описывается функция TBDEDirect.GoToRecord, позволяющая перейти к указанной записи в базе данных.

:: Как получить номер записи в dBASE или Paradox
Представлен код функции FindRecordNumber, которая позволяет получить номер записи в дата-сете dBASE или Paradox.

:: Как узнать содержание активной записи в БД
Функция TBDEDirect.GetCurRecord позволяет получить содержание активной записи в БД как указатель на строку.

:: Копирование записи в пределах одной и той же таблицы
Копирование записи в пределах одной и той же таблицы Delphi позволяет использовать два TTable, связанных с одной таблицей, для позиционирования курсора на нужной строке в первой таблице и добавления этой строки в 第二ую таблицу.

:: Копирование записи из одной таблицы в другую
В статье представлен код на Delphi, который позволяет копировать записи из одной таблицы в другую.

:: Не получается вставить в таблицу записи со строками на русском языке
Не получается вставить в таблицу записи со строками на русском языке, но можно использовать функцию SetTableRussianLanguage для установки русского LANGDRIVER для таблицы BDE (Paradox или dBASE).

:: Отобразить строку специфической записи
В статье описывается пример использования рекорда TEmployee с массивами char для хранения данных об employee, а также процедура ParseData, которая извлекает и обрабатывает эти данные.

:: Получение уникального номера, под которым можно вставить запись в таблицу
Функция GetId для получения уникального номера для вставки записи в таблицу, при условии что первое поле является уникальным и ключевым.

:: Предохранение от автодобавления записи
Предотвратить автоматическое добавление записи в таблицу можно с помощью предохранителя на основе ASCII-кода клавиши, который вызывает исключение при нажатии на клавишу Backspace (код 45).

:: При обращении клиента, к уже редактируемой записи другим клиентом, выдаётся сообщение
При обращении клиента к уже редактируемой записи другим клиентом выдаётся сообщение о занятости записи.

:: Создание уникального ID для новой записи
Создание уникального ID для новой записи может быть выполнено с помощью поля с автоприращением, ID-таблицы или ID-файла, но первый способ не рекомендуется в случаях, когда таблица будет пересобранная, а второй и третий способы обеспечивают последовательно

:: Стандартный запрос на удаление записи в таблице
Статья описывает стандартный запрос на удаление записи в таблице, а также предоставляет код на языке Pascal для процедуры DelRec, которая подтверждает удаление перед выполнением Delete.

:: Удаление большого количества записей
Удаление большого количества записей может стать проблемой при отсутствии знаний по архитектуре InterBase, особенно при использовании неуникальных индексов, которые могут влиять на скорость сборки мусора и операций удаления.


Узнайте все о работе с записями в базе данных на Delphi. В этом разделе представлены статьи об управлении записями в БД, включая функции перехода к записи, вставки новой записи, копирования и удаления записей. Также рассматриваются проблемы при работе со строками на русском языке и способы их решения.



Получайте свежие новости и обновления по Object Pascal, Delphi и Lazarus прямо в свой смартфон. Подпишитесь на наш Telegram-канал delphi_kansoftware и будьте в курсе последних тенденций в разработке под Linux, Windows, Android и iOS

:: Главная ::


реклама


©KANSoftWare (разработка программного обеспечения, создание программ, создание интерактивных сайтов), 2007
Top.Mail.Ru

Время компиляции файла: 2024-08-19 13:29:56
2024-10-23 10:24:34/0.0036029815673828/0